Our first concept-phase product is AINO, a robot designed for interaction and as a support tool for the care industry.
Finnish design, AINO is an assistant robot created to function independently. Its design prioritizes both aesthetics and approachability, ensuring it has an easy-to-use, ergonomic form.
The product incorporates thoughtful
technical solutions, ensuring it can serve as a versatile assistive tool
in various tasks, either independently or with the help of a nurse.

The modular adaptability of AINO, along with its sensor technology and AI-powered functions, gives the end user the ability to customize the product to perfectly suit their needs.
AINO is a robot designed to assist in tasks such as working with the elderly and supporting nurses by enabling remote monitoring of seniors' well-being and safety, particularly in nursing homes where the number of residents may exceed the number of caregivers.

Seppo has extensive experience in universities, particularly in teaching, research, and the development of research equipment, as well as product development in industry and his own company.
He holds a Master's degree in Physics from the university and a Licentiate degree in Engineering with a focus on Electronics from a technical university.
At Massai Sense, he is responsible for the company's technological solutions and envisions how Human Technology can enhance the safety and quality of life for the elderly, while also generating cost savings for seniors, their families, and service providers.
Matti has experience in professional electronics design, product quality management, and international marketing and procurement. He has a long background as an IT engineer educator, having worked as a lecturer both in Finland and in Singapore, providing commercial auditing services across Asia. In recent years, he has also extensively offered innovation and startup coaching.
Matti holds a Master's degree in Engineering from the Technical University of Otaniemi, specializing in automation technology applications and international business.
At Massai Sense, Matti is responsible for the international marketing and sales of products and services, as well as ensuring product and service quality while considering customers' lifecycle requirements.
Aki combines strong product design and conceptualization skills with a passion for future technologies as part of product development. With versatile experience as a product designer, he has worked on both digital and physical product designs. His experience with various manufacturing methods, along with expertise in PDM, CAD, and CAM software, gives him a comprehensive understanding of the product development process from concept to finished product.
Aki holds a degree in Industrial Design (BBA) and has further enhanced his expertise with studies in visual and audio communication (BBA), Information and Communication Technology, and CNC technology.
At Massai Sense, Aki serves as the lead product and concept designer, also contributing to product marketing and production planning.
